Output a180b4d4484a669cdb99e68505b807a6bbd54e11ab5b2df279e26e647f3154bf:2

value
557415
script pubkey
OP_0 OP_PUSHBYTES_20 89507577efc04a0901d1581f0ce3b77c4924692d
address
tb1q39g82al0cp9qjqw3tq0secah03yjg6fdd0325t
transaction
a180b4d4484a669cdb99e68505b807a6bbd54e11ab5b2df279e26e647f3154bf
confirmations
135132
spent
true